Historical Events on January 16

History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on January 16th.

YearEvent
1883The Pendleton Civil Service Reform Act, establishing the United States Civil Service, is enacted by Congress.
1900The United States Senate accepts the Anglo-German treaty of 1899 in which the United Kingdom renounces its claims to the Samoan islands.
1909Ernest Shackleton's expedition finds the magnetic South Pole.
1919Nebraska becomes the 36th state to approve the Eighteenth Amendment to the United States Constitution. With the necessary three-quarters of the states approving the amendment, Prohibition is constitutionally mandated in the United States one year later.
1920The League of Nations holds its first council meeting in Paris, France.
1921The Marxist Left in Slovakia and the Transcarpathian Ukraine holds its founding congress in Ľubochňa.
1942Crash of TWA Flight 3, killing all 22 aboard, including film star Carole Lombard.
1942The Holocaust: Nazi Germany begins deporting Jews from the Łódź Ghetto to Chełmno extermination camp.
1945World War II: Adolf Hitler moves into his underground bunker, the so-called Führerbunker.
1959Austral Líneas Aéreas Flight 205 crashes into the Atlantic Ocean near Astor Piazzolla International Airport in Mar del Plata, Argentina, killing 51.

Popular Baby Name on January 16, 2000

In 2000,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Jacob is the most used. A total of 34,483 baby boys were named Jacob in 2000. The rest were named Michael, Matthew, Joshua and Christopher. While the popular baby girl name in 2000 was Emily. There were 25,957 baby girls named Emily that year. While the rest were named Hannah, Madison, Ashley and Sarah.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
